iPhone 4 - extra metal part, not contact clip

Yup, I'm embarrassed. I'm finishing a rebuild for an iPhone 4, and I have an extra metal part...looks to be a cover with two screw holes. It's not the contact clip.

Thats the contact clip that goes around the mute on/off switch on the side of the handset.

You'll find that it doesnt work as when you switch the mute button across, the little hook shape part pulls another hard switch internally.

Can always adjust the volume settings internally via the phone settings if you cant be bothered stripping it down again.
